    Teamspeak can be downloaded at http://www.goteamspeak.com. In the upper right hand corner of the main page there is an area called Quick Downloads. Click TS2 Client under the Windows heading. The server is only needed if you want to host your own server. Both are free to download and use.

    As for how to get it, just check out various online stores if you can't get it locally. Some will ship outside of the US. "Falcon 4.0: Allied Force" is what you are looking for. I noticed some sites listed it as "Gold Edition" and some did not, but from reading the product discriptions and looking at the box photos, I don't think there are two different versions. I thought maybe it was the "Featuring New Operations Theater: The Balkans" but all listings had this whether it listed it as Gold Edition or not. I just got it a week ago myself so can anyone confirm this?

    I'll be conducting a F4AF orientation training flight on Thursday September 1 at 9:00 PM EST. I have two available slots, so you can reply to this message if you want to sign up.

    Topics will include:

    Joining F4AF multiplayer servers & standard operating procedures
    Recommended settings
    Introduction to briefings/pre-flight
    Cockpit familiarization
    Takeoff
    Basic navigation
    Landing

    If time permits, we'll delve a little into air-to-ground weapon delivery, because everyone likes to blow stuff up. Otherwise we'll save it for the next training session.

    This is "Falcon 101" and we'll stick to the basics for this flight, so all skill levels are quite welcome!

    And if you can't make this flight, let me know and we'll schedule more as needed.
